Eligibility |
From the bequest of Elva S. Corrigill, widow of Alexander Stevenson Corrigill (B. Arch. '19) who was the first graduate in Architecture of the University of Manitoba, a scholarship fund has been established at the University of Manitoba.
From this fund a total of 8 scholarships will be awarded to students who:
have clear standing in their study programs of previous year in the university;
have high standing on a full study program in the academic year on which the award is based;
proceed in the next ensuing academic year to the next year in course in full-time enrolment within the Faculty of Architecture.
These scholarships are tenable with other awards open to students in the Faculty of Architecture. If a student to whom one of these scholarships is offered does not register in the next ensuing year as required, his or her scholarship will be awarded by reversion to the next qualified student. |
